[Kde-bindings] KDE/kdebindings/kalyptus
Richard Dale
Richard_Dale at tipitina.demon.co.uk
Wed Oct 24 16:37:34 UTC 2007
SVN commit 728908 by rdale:
* Attempt to remove all references to QDebug in the Smoke library so that it will build
in the dashboard environment
CCMAIL: kde-bindings at kde.org
M +4 -0 kalyptusCxxToKimono.pm
M +4 -0 kalyptusCxxToSmoke.pm
--- trunk/KDE/kdebindings/kalyptus/kalyptusCxxToKimono.pm #728907:728908
@@ -820,12 +820,16 @@
|| $name eq 'handle'
|| ($name eq 'qt_metacall')
|| ($name eq 'metaObject')
+ || $name eq 'qWarning'
+ || $name eq 'qCritical'
+ || $name eq 'qDebug'
|| ($m->{ReturnType} =~ /iterator/)
|| ($classNode->{astNodeName} eq 'QApplication' and $name eq 'QApplication')
|| ($classNode->{astNodeName} eq 'QCoreApplication' and $name eq 'QCoreApplication')
|| ($classNode->{astNodeName} eq 'TextEvent' and $name eq 'data')
|| ($classNode->{astNodeName} eq 'KConfigGroup' and $name eq 'groupImpl')
|| ($classNode->{astNodeName} eq 'KConfigGroup' and $name eq 'setReadDefaults')
+ || 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Debug/ )
|| 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/KDateTime::Spec/ )
|| ($name eq 'operator>>'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/KDateTime::Spec/ )
|| 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/const KDateTime/ )
--- trunk/KDE/kdebindings/kalyptus/kalyptusCxxToSmoke.pm #728907:728908
@@ -440,9 +440,13 @@
|| $name eq 'qt_metacast'
|| $name eq 'virtual_hook'
|| $name eq 'handle'
+ || $name eq 'qWarning'
+ || $name eq 'qCritical'
+ || $name eq 'qDebug'
|| ($classNode->{astNodeName} eq 'TextEvent' and $name eq 'data')
|| ($classNode->{astNodeName} eq 'KConfigGroup' and $name eq 'groupImpl')
|| ($classNode->{astNodeName} eq 'KConfigGroup' and $name eq 'setReadDefaults')
+ || 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Debug/ )
|| 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/KDateTime::Spec/ )
|| ($name eq 'operator>>'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/KDateTime::Spec/ )
|| ($name eq 'operator<<' and $m->{ParamList}[0]->{ArgType} =~ /QDataStream/ and $m->{ParamList}[1]->{ArgType} =~ /const KDateTime/ )
More information about the Kde-bindings
mailing list